Abstract

We evaluated 44 novel cationic compounds for activity against metronidazole-sensitive and -resistant Trichomonas vaginalis isolates. Six compounds in three different structural classes demonstrated 50% inhibitory concentrations as low as 1 μM against both sensitive and resistant isolates, suggesting a mode of action independent of parasite biochemical pathways that confer resistance to 5-nitroimidazoles.
